Originally Posted by 2500HeavyDuty
Watch the afc video and wondred about the starwheel, when you rotate it it pushes the fuel pin lower down, and since the ACF pin is cone shaped the lower the fuel pin is then the less fuel that is going to be deliverd. cause the profile of the AFC is wider at the bottom. How would that give it more fuel then by roating the star wheel down it would be starting it off in a position where the fuel pin is pushed back giving it less fuel.
The star wheel adjustment only increases how soon and how much boost it takes to move the fuel pin down for more fuel. Just more of a "tuning" adjustment.
